EU Bans planes from Zambia
The European Commission has banned all airlines from Zambia.
According to EU media reports, the EU removed a ban from flying to Europe on four Indonesian airlines, while at the same time banning all airlines from Zambia and Kazakhstan, except Air Astana, it said Tuesday.
The commission has a “black list” of airlines that aren’t allowed to fly to the European Union because of safety concerns, and it updates it regularly.
“Since the imposition of the ban in July 2007, four air carriers – Garuda Indonesia, Airfast Indonesia, Mandala Airlines and Premiair – can be taken off the list, because their authority ensures that they respect the international safety standards,” the commission said in a statement.
At the same time, safety deficiencies have led to the ban of the other companies, it added.
All air carriers certified by the Zambia authorities with
responsibility for regulatory oversight, including the newly launched Zambezi Airlines are banned.

The airlines that have been banned from Zambia are the Zambian registered airlines and/or those to be registered. In Zambia’s case it is not an issue with any specific Airline per se but the perceived inadequate capacity of civil aviation authorities to enforce and maintain regulatory standards of safety. It is an indictment of govt rather than the airlines. In simple words: the EU does not have faith in the Zambian govt’s capacity to regulate and maintain safety standards of the Airlines that are registered by the Zambian govt. Second, it may have come to the notice of EU civil aviation officials that the Zambian registered Airlines are using very old second hand planes. This is why even the Angolan Airlines has been banned except for their new fleet of Boeing 777s which is still allowed to fly into Lisbon.
